- The systems engineering certification integration analyst will
coordinate with program leaders, design engineers, unit members,
and regulators to ensure that production and development
certification projects are defined and executed to support 737
program requirements.
- Provides support for the development of certification plans and
negotiate changes required in order to secure approval of
certification plan by regulatory agencies. Identifies the data
elements for configuration status accounting and reporting,
identifies and deploys tools to support data collection and
reporting.
- Performs configuration verification/ Major Minor audits.
- Drive completion of IPT work statement to ensure that key
program milestones are met (ie Cert Plan submittal, cert basis,
TIA, Type board, PSOC, and incremental closure)
- Provide support and coordination for certification basis
edits
- Provide support and coordination with IPT and Reg admin for
completion of DDL/DDC and ADs for ATC projects
- Coordinate with CPOS and track/manage cert plans and cert plan
deliverables to ensure timely submittals
- Oversees training, leads and mentors others.
